Sports park with a view

Sep 13, 2019

image alt text

The Shiba water Stations Park is a public park where kids can play football in the heart of urban Tokyo. What it must be to be able to play in the shadow of the iconic Tokyo Tower, from where this photograph was taken.

One of the things I like about Tokyo are the many small oases of green scattered between the apartment blocks and business high-rises.

districtlandmarkparktokyo towerminatoshibakoen

Colourful Play Park

Sakura Waters